The Lord’s Word Is a Lamp unto Our Feet

Psalm 119:105

105 Thy word is a lamp unto my feet, and a light unto my path.

President Harold B. Lee said:

“I say that we need to teach our people to find their answers in the scriptures. If only each of us would be wise enough to say that we aren’t able to answer any question unless we can find a doctrinal answer in the scriptures! And if we hear someone teaching something that is contrary to what is in the scriptures, each of us may know whether the things spoken are false—it is as simple as that. But the unfortunate thing is that so many of us are not reading the scriptures. We do not know what is in them, and therefore we speculate about the things that we ought to have found in the scriptures themselves. I think that therein is one of our biggest dangers of today.

“When I meet with our missionaries and they ask questions about things pertaining to the temple, I say to them, as I close the discussion, ‘I don’t dare answer any of your questions unless I can find an answer in the standard works or in the authentic declarations of presidents of the Church.’

“The Lord has given us in the standard works the means by which we should measure truth and untruth. May we all heed his word: ‘Thou shalt take the things which thou hast received, which have been given unto thee in my scriptures for a law, to be my law to govern my church’ (D&C 42:59).”

(“Find the Answers in the Scriptures,” Ensign, Dec. 1972, 3.)
